This place exists and it is called Kauai, Hawaii.  It is the northernmost, geologically oldest, and most breathtakingly beautiful of all of the Hawaiian Islands. Known as the “Garden Isle”, Kauai is world famous for it’s rich and colorful nature, although, many visitors may be surprised to learn that the majority of the bright flowers aren’t native to Hawaii, settlers sailing from the Philippians first brought them there many years ago.IMG_0150It is the home of two sprawling botanical gardens, as well as The Waimea Canyon State Park, which actually features a real canyon referred to as the “Grand Canyon of the Pacific” by none other than Mark Twain. But one of the more amazing attractions in Kauai is the spectacular marvel that is the Na Pali Coast. With its majestic cliffs towering over the sparkling water, it’s easy to understand how Kauai got its nickname.IMG_0188Want to experience it?
